Earnings for Biomedical Engineering Graduates from Saint Louis University
Graduates of Saint Louis University’s Biomedical Engineering program earn at the following median levels (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 1 year | $55,882 |
| 5 years | $58,898 |
Median Debt at Graduation
Median student loan debt for Biomedical Engineering graduates from Saint Louis University is $27,000.

Biomedical Engineering Bachelor’s Program at Saint Louis University
Among the 20 bachelor’s biomedical engineering graduates at Saint Louis University, 55% were women (11) and 45% were men (9).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Biomedical Engineering bachelor’s degree recipients at Saint Louis University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 15 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 1 |
| Asian | 2 |
| Two or More Races | 1 |
| International (Nonresident) | 1 |
Minority students account for 20% of Biomedical Engineering bachelor’s degree recipients at Saint Louis University, below the national average of 44%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
